Win32 Perl Programming. The Standard Extensions, Second Edition, is the single most comprehensive guide to Perl's Win32 extensions available. No other source provides as much technical details, insight, and explanations as are found within these pages. Win32 system administrators, programmers, webmasters, consultants, and anyone else who uses Perl on Win32 machines will find this book invaluable. It provides vital information on using Perl's Win32 extensions that cannot be found anywhere else. With expert insight and attention to detail, author Dave Roth explores the hows, whys, and whats surrounding these mysterious extensions. If you're a Win32 or UNIX administrator, programmer, or webmaster, this book will help you: Learn how to manipulate the Registry; Determine how Perl can exploit Win32 security; Use COM and automation from Perl; Manage user and group accounts. Intended for intermediate - to advanced level users, this authoritative guide offers instruction on: Interacting with ODBC to access any database; Discovering how to call into any DLL library; Manipulating files and finding file version information; Creating and synchronizing processes; Writing your own extensions with step-by-step instruction.

Dave Roth is the contributor of various popular Win32 Perl Extensions, including Win32::ODBC, Win32::AdminMisc, Win32::Daemon, and Win32::Perms, and has been providing solutions to the Perl community since 1994. Dave has been a speaker at the O¿Reilly Perl and USENIX LISA NT conferences. He has contributed to The Perl Journal and is the author of Win32 Perl Scripting: The Administrator¿s Handbook (1578702151, New Riders, 10/00). Dave has been programming since 1981 in various languages, from assembler to C++, LPC and Perl. His code is used by organizations as diverse as Microsoft, the U.S. Department of Defense, Disney, Industrial Light and Magic, Digital Paper,Hewlett-Packard, Metagenix, Radcom, and various colleges and universities. Formerly, Dave helped assemble and admister a statewide WAN for the state of Michigan, and he has designed and administered LANs for Ameritech and Michigan State University.
